spotless


adjective

  • Very clean and tidy.
  • Without any dirt or marks.
  • Completely clean and neat.


Synonym

  • immaculate
  • spick-and-span
  • unsullied

Sentences

  • The kitchen was spotless after dinner.
  • Her spotless homework got a gold star.
  • The car looks spotless after the wash.
  • He keeps his toys spotless and organized.
  • The garden is spotless with no weeds.

Word Explanation:

  • Spotless means something is super clean, with no spots or mess at all. Like a shiny, clean table.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does 'spotless' mean?

'Spotless' means very clean and without any spots or dirt.

How do you pronounce 'spotless'?

You pronounce 'spotless' like this: spot-less.

What is the origin of the word 'spotless'?

The word 'spotless' comes from the word 'spot', which means a small mark or stain, and 'less', which means without.

What is the meaning of 'spotless' in Bengali?

The word 'spotless' in Bengali is 'দাগহীন' (Dāghīna).
